WebThe main way that shift work affects your physical health is by throwing off your body’s natural circadian rhythm. This is the internal process that regulates your 24-hour sleep cycle. Humans are not nocturnal creatures. They are naturally meant to be awake and functioning during the day and asleep during the night. WebWhen you stay awake all night or otherwise go against natural light cycles, your health may suffer. Long-term disruption of circadian rhythms has been linked to obesity, diabetes, …

WebWhat Are the Effects of Worker Fatigue? Worker fatigue increases the risk for illnesses and injuries. Accident and injury rates 1 are 18% greater during evening shifts and 30% greater during night shifts when compared to day shifts.
